I have a very good condition 1995 Buick Regal Custom with the series I 3800 engine. It has just over 125,661 original miles on it but has engine problems. I have the Carfax report for when I bought it (Jan. of this year). The car runs (barely) and I honestly don't know how far you'd be able to drive it so towing it would probably be ideal. The engine seems to have a serious mechanical issue(s). It runs like it's only using four cylinders. The 'low coolant level' warning has been off/on this past week, but coolant isn't low by physically checking it. I bought this car as temporary transportation while I fixed my truck but now it has to go. Truck is now gone and I I now have another car to drive. I'm selling this car 'AS-IS'. It did pass emissions 'with flying colors' when I registered it in Duluth. The interior of this car is in really, really good condition. The rear carpet below the window and top of rear seats have sun fading, but the rest of the seats and carpet are in EXCELLENT condition for the age of the car. Captain's chair on driver's side works perfectly. (motorized adjustments) I recently checked the compression on all cylinders and they were consistently around 180 psi. I've put standard Delco plugs, and wires ($50). I replaced one coil pack a few weeks ago as it was putting out an erratic spark. This made it run better, but over the last two weeks, it's gotten much worse and I don't have the time or energy to mess with the car. The motor is the legendary Series I with aluminum heads. From what I've read, this engine had far fewer problems than the series II (96 and up..), but in my case this doesn't matter since it'll have to have work done to it, or replaced. I'm not a mechanic and don't know the extent to what will have to be done to get it back to where it should be. I did take it to a mechanic and he was wanting to charge me to change the upper and lower intake gaskets again thinking the previous job wasn't done right. I'm very skeptical however that this would fix the problem. The previous owner did replace the lower and upper intake manifold gaskets, and water pump.
